Questions to Ask Potential Rental Companies
Prior to partnering with a property management firm, it is wise to inquire about their procedures and services. Consider these questions:
- What is your approach to tenant screening and background verifications?
- What is your fee structure and are there any hidden costs?
- How are maintenance issues managed and how fast can they respond?
- Can you provide references from other property owners or renters?
These questions help ensure that you grasp what you’re getting and that the company’s practices match your needs. It’s always best to select a company that is transparent about all details.

Marketing and Tenant Screening
A key role of property management is marketing rental properties to draw in the right tenants. In Mobile, AL, a multitude of properties are vying for attention, and property management companies ensure your listing stands out. They use multiple channels to advertise available properties in Mobile and nearby locations such as Prichard AL, Bromley AL, and Grand Bay AL.
Tenant screening is a key aspect. Firms often conduct thorough background checks including employment, credit history, and rental references. This process ensures that only qualified tenants move into the property, reducing the risk of late payments or damage. By having experts handle these tasks, landlords can feel more confident about their rental income and property upkeep.
